Understanding Pallet StorageWhat is Pallet Storage?
Pallet storage includes using pallet racks and racks to arrange the storage of products, generally in a warehouse or distribution center. Pallets are flat transport structures that facilitate the handling and motion of materials. They can be made from different materials, including wood, plastic, and metal, differing on weight capacity and resilience.
Kinds Of Pallet Storage Systems
Pallet storage can be categorized into numerous types, each serving specific needs:
Type of Pallet StorageDescriptionBest ForSelective RackingThe most typical and versatile system, enabling simple access to all pallets.Fast-moving stockDrive-In RackingA high-density storage system where forklifts go into the racks to position or obtain pallets.Large amounts of comparable productsPress Back RackingPallets are filled onto carts that roll back on rails, enabling Last In, First Out (LIFO) access.Products with varying needPallet Flow RackingA gravity-fed system with rollers, allowing pallets to flow from the back to the front.FIFO (First In, First Out) inventory managementCantilever RackingPerfect for saving long, bulky items that can not rest on conventional flat surfaces.Lumber, pipelines, and other long item typesBenefits of Efficient Pallet Storage

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ION: Pallet StorageQ1: What are the standard sizes of pallets?
The most common pallet size is the 48" x 40" GMA pallet used in the U.S. However, variations exist, consisting of Euro pallets (47" x 31") and block pallets (used worldwide in different measurements).
Q2: How much weight can a standard wooden pallet hold?
Requirement wooden Pallets Storage usually have a weight capability varying from 1,500 to 3,000 pounds, depending upon their construction quality and the circulation of weight throughout the pallet.
Q3: What kind of pallet is best for global shipping?
Plastic pallets are often thought about the very best choice for worldwide shipping due to their toughness, tidiness, and compliance with international guidelines.
Q4: How do I prevent damage to pallets during storage?
Make sure pallets are stacked correctly, avoid overloading, store them in a climate-controlled environment when essential, and perform routine inspections for damage.
Q5: How often should I inspect my pallet storage system?
Routine examinations ought to be carried out a minimum of when a month, with more regular checks during high-traffic periods or after any events involving pallet use.
